Question

J'ai un fichier LESS très simple qui, pour l'instant, importe simplement Bootstrap.j'utilise grunt et grunt-contrib-less@0.9.0 pour compiler les fichiers LESS lors de la sauvegarde (less@1.6.3).

Mon fichier ressemble à ceci :

@charset "utf-8";
/**
 * This is the root style file for the app
 * to include styles in your html, you only need to include either:
 *  dist/styles.dev.css (for development)
 *  dist/styles.css (for production)
 */

// Libraries
@import "../lib/bootstrap/less/bootstrap"

// Our own files

et j'obtiens l'erreur suivante chaque fois que j'essaie d'exécuter mon less:dev tâche.

Running "less:dev" (less) task
>> ParseError: Unrecognised input in style/styles.less on line 10, column 1:
>> 9 // Libraries
>> 10 @import "../lib/bootstrap/less/bootstrap"
>> 11

J'ai essayé de tout supprimer du fichier sauf la ligne d'importation et cela échoue toujours, donc quelque chose de bizarre se passe avec le @import directif.

Des idées?

Était-ce utile?

La solution

Utilisez un point-virgule après @import

@import "../lib/bootstrap/less/bootstrap";
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top